The Elephant Whisperers follows an indigenous couple as they fall in love with Raghu, an orphaned elephant given into their care, and tirelessly work to ensure his recovery & survival. The film highlights the beauty of the wild spaces in South India and the people and animals who share this space.

The Elephant Whisperers tells the story of an indigenous couple who care for Raghu, an orphaned elephant. Their journey of love and dedication highlights the connection between humans and wildlife in South India, showcasing the challenges and joys of nurturing a vulnerable creature amidst the backdrop of nature.
